DT8 3DT is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on East Street, 0.3km from Gerrard's Green in Beaminster. Administratively it sits within Beaminster ward and the West Dorset const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in DT8, DT8 3DT offers a spacious suburb popular with older working households approaching retirement. Outside of residential hours, mainly white older workforce, self-employed in agriculture, forestry and fishing, with some construction. The 60 average age marks this as a deeply established neighbourhood — expect quiet streets, long-term homeowners, and strong community continuity. 83%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 19 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£358k, down 17.8% year-on-year.

Census 2021 statistics for DT8 3DT are sourced from Output Area E00103902 (shared with 12 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
